What Is Dysphagia?
Dysphagia describes problem ingesting, which can come from different causes such as stroke, head and neck cancers, or neurodegenerative conditions. Clients with dysphagia may experience pain while ingesting (odynophagia), an experience of food being embeded the throat or upper body, and even coughing throughout meals.
